Transaction 80e7677992786856f04f08e0ea0a192bc5b52d7f9df3be296cc7de302be42dcd
1 Input
1 Output
-
80e7677992786856f04f08e0ea0a192bc5b52d7f9df3be296cc7de302be42dcd:0
- value
- 423526
- script pubkey
- OP_0 OP_PUSHBYTES_20 faeaf936cb0d26c936b78317f1d5577be6b08a0f
- address
- bc1qlt40jdktp5nvjd4hsvtlr42h00ntpzs0cvpslv